Rep. Juan Ciscomani says a border bill can still be worked on in the House

Published | Video Starts at 03:48

What we could do very quickly here is the president could end catch and release now. He could end the exploitation of parole authority. He could reinstate. Remain in Mexico. Remain in Mexico alone...would decrease the entries by over 70%. over 70%. That one measure alone, if you had to choose one, that's the one that I would choose. Expand the expedited removal authority and renewing the wall, the building of the wall. (03:48–03:56)

CLAIM

Asserts that reinstating the 'Remain in Mexico' policy would reduce border entries by over 70%.
